Checking out the Variety: Types of Bunk Beds for Adults
The world of adult bunk beds is remarkably diverse, providing a series of styles and setups to suit various needs and choices. Here are some popular types:
- Standard Bunk Beds: The classic vertical stacking design, including 2 beds straight above one another. These are the most space-efficient alternative and are ideal for taking full advantage of sleeping area in a compact room. Modern versions typically include sturdier frames and trendy ladder styles.
- Loft Beds: Technically a single top bunk bed, loft beds offer a raised sleeping platform with open space underneath. This area can be used for a desk, a seating area, storage, or perhaps a walk-in closet. Loft beds are best for maximizing performance in a studio house or bedroom, producing a multi-purpose zone.
- Futon Bunk Beds: Combining a leading bunk bed with a futon or sofa bed on the bottom, these versatile choices use both sleeping and lounging space. The futon can be used as a sofa throughout the day and unfolded into a bed at night, supplying versatility for living areas that require to serve several functions.
- L-Shaped Bunk Beds: In this setup, the leading bunk is put perpendicularly over the lower bunk, creating an “L” shape. This design provides more headspace for the lower bunk resident and can sometimes develop a little nook or corner in the space. They are a good choice for somewhat larger spaces where a conventional stacked bunk bed may feel too enforcing.
- Trundle Bunk Beds: These include a pull-out trundle bed below the lower bunk, offering a beauty sleep surface area when required. Trundle bunk beds are excellent for accommodating periodic visitors or for families who wish to be gotten ready for unexpected slumber parties.
- Triple Bunk Beds: Designed to sleep three individuals, these can be set up in a vertical stack of three beds or in other setups, depending upon the design. Triple bunk beds are particularly beneficial in shared living spaces, hostels, or for large households.
Secret Considerations When Choosing an Adult Bunk Bed
Buying a bunk bed for adults requires careful consideration to guarantee safety, comfort, and viability for the desired space and users. Here are essential factors to keep in mind:
- Weight Capacity: This is vital for adult usage. Make sure the bunk bed is particularly created and rated to support the weight of adults. Inspect the manufacturer's specifications and look for models developed with robust materials and durable building.
- Durability and Safety: Beyond weight capability, assess the total toughness of the frame. Search for strong construction, reinforced joints, and safe and secure ladder attachments. Safety features like strong guardrails on the leading bunk are important to avoid falls.
- Size and Dimensions: Carefully determine the available space, thinking about both floor location and ceiling height. Ensure there is appropriate headroom for both the leading and bottom bunk occupants to stay up conveniently. Also, think about the general footprint of the bed and how it will fit within the space, leaving enough space for movement and other furnishings.
- Material and Style: Choose materials and designs that complement your existing design and individual preferences. Options range from metal frames, which typically provide a modern or commercial visual, to wooden frames, which can produce a warmer, more standard feel. Think about sturdiness and ease of upkeep when choosing materials.
- Ladder Design and Accessibility: The ladder ought to be strong, firmly attached, and easy to climb up for adults. Think about the angle and width of the actions. Some bunk beds provide angled ladders or ladders with broader steps for enhanced ease of access. For those with movement concerns, the ladder design ends up being a lot more important.
- Mattress Compatibility and Height: Bunk beds often have height constraints for mattresses to preserve security rail clearance. Examine buy bunk bed for bed mattress thickness and guarantee your picked mattress will fit correctly and adhere to safety standards.
- Assembly and Ease of Setup: Consider the assembly process. Some bunk beds are simpler to assemble than others. Read evaluations or examine assembly directions beforehand to assess the intricacy and ensure you have the required tools or help.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) about Bunk Beds for Adults:
Q: Are bunk beds safe for adults?A: Yes, when chosen and utilized properly. Guarantee the bunk bed is particularly designed for adult weight capability, is made of durable materials, and has safety features like guardrails. Constantly follow the producer's directions for assembly and weight limits.
Q: What is the weight capability of adult bunk beds?A: Weight capabilities differ by model and producer. Always check the item requirements, but typically, adult bunk beds can support weights varying from 200 lbs per bunk to significantly more, with some durable choices going beyond 500 lbs per bunk.
Q: Are bunk beds comfy for adults?A: Yes, adult bunk beds can be comfy. Comfort primarily depends on the mattress quality and the general style. Choose an encouraging bed mattress that fits the bunk bed frame and think about features like headroom and legroom when selecting a design.
Q: What type of bed mattress is best for a bunk bed?A: Typically, thinner bed mattress are suggested for bunk beds due to height restrictions and security rail clearance. Memory foam, latex, or innerspring bed mattress around 6-8 inches thick are often suitable. Always check the manufacturer's recommendations for bed mattress thickness.
